On Thu, Oct 30, 2025, at 15:00, Andy Shevchenko wrote:
> On Thu, Oct 30, 2025 at 11:22:11AM +0100, Christian Marangi wrote:
>> On Thu, Oct 30, 2025 at 10:27:38AM +0200, Andy Shevchenko wrote:
>> > On Wed, Oct 29, 2025 at 04:38:53PM +0100, Christian Marangi wrote:

>> drivers/soc/qcom/smem.c:361:35: error: initializer element is not constant
>>   361 | static struct qcom_smem *__smem = ERR_PTR(-EPROBE_DEFER);
>>       |                                   ^~~~~~~
>> make[9]: *** [scripts/Makefile.build:229: drivers/soc/qcom/smem.o] Error 1
>> 
>> You want me to add this to the commit? Or any hint to better reword this
>> so it's more understandable?
>
> Just the first line would be enough.
> And perhaps better naming for the macro, but I have no ideas from top of my
> head right now. Ah, actually I do. We call those either INIT_*() or DEFINE_*()
> with the difference that INIT_*() works like your proposed idea. i.e. returns
> a suitable value, but DEFINE_*() incorporates a variable and a type.
>
> I think the INIT_ERR_PTR() is what we want as a name.

Agreed, that seems better than ERR_PTR_CONST(). I'm still not sure
there is much benefit in using this in static initializers, but
I don't mind it either.
